## Step 6: Enable the Kiosk Watchdog

The Ostrell kiosk app relies on a watchdog process (ostrell-wd) that restarts the renderer if it stops heartbeating for 15 seconds. Before enabling it, confirm the heartbeat socket path in watchdog.conf matches the renderer's config, or the watchdog will loop-restart a healthy app. Set the restart backoff to at least 10 seconds to avoid thrashing on slow hardware. Finally, the watchdog authenticates to the fleet reporting service with a credential stored in the env file. Append this line to kiosk.env:

vault entry, yajop-bafop: ARCHIVE_KEY3=8d4

Key ceremony checklist — item 7 (Tracewise rollout). Before we rotate the signing key for the trace-header service, double-check that span propagation still works across the billing and notify microservices — support gets flooded when trace IDs drop. Once both ceremony witnesses sign off, unlock the recovery bundle. The passphrase you'll need for that bundle is noted just below this line.

strongbox words: sorir-belvan-rusix-ulays-ralmir-praix-eliir-tamax-praael-druael-julir-tamius-jorir

Hi,

The cut-over of the Marrowlight telemetry pipeline to compressed payloads completed last night without incident. All collector nodes now negotiate compression with agents at connect time; agents on older builds fall back to plaintext automatically, so nothing was dropped. Bandwidth on the ingest link fell roughly sixty percent, and decompression overhead on the collectors stayed well under the budget we agreed. For your records, the pipeline is now running with the following configuration values.

config for tagep-yajef:
ulawyn:
  log_level: error
  metrics_host: metrics.ulawyn.lumiclabs.internal
  pin: 0564
  pool_size: 32

**Q: Why did a driver get assigned from two zones away?**

Short version: the Routabout heuristic weighs idle time, not just distance. A driver who's been waiting a while can beat a closer one. Totally normal, not a bug — tell the customer ETA is still accurate. If you need to override an assignment, open the dispatch override panel, which unlocks with the passphrase below.

strongbox words: sordor-druix